What is composting?
Composting is the method of saving natural (which means, natural matter – not within the sense of natural vs. standard farming) materials comparable to vegetable/fruit scraps and leaves and recycling them into soil.
To do that at residence, this merely means saving these meals scraps (extra particulars under on what you’ll be able to and might’t compost) in a container, then both dumping them into a bigger bin outdoors to decompose, or transporting them to a drop off location close to you.

Why compost?
About 95 p.c of meals scraps within the U.S. are thrown away, ending up in landfills. (supply)
Recycling this natural matter somewhat than throwing it away saves it from ending up in landfills, the place it’ll take up area and launch methane, a potent greenhouse fuel. (Hi, international warming.)
According to the EPA, meals scraps and yard waste collectively make up greater than 28% of what we throw away – however it may be composted as an alternative!

Can I compost and not using a yard?
Yes! Many areas provide composting decide up companies, or have drop off places out there (like at farmer’s markets).
If you don’t have entry to an out of doors area to position a bigger compost bin, take a look at this record to seek out composting choices close to you. Or simply Google “compost service in…” your metropolis!
What precisely can I compost?
More than you suppose!
Here are the fundamentals of what to compost: vegetable waste, fruit scraps, espresso grounds, egg shells, tea baggage (take away the staple!), shredded paper (not shiny), paper towels (as long as they don’t have any chemical substances/oils on them), leaves, branches, and twigs.

What shouldn’t be composted?
You wish to keep away from including any meat, dairy, and fats to your compost.
So, nothing with numerous oil/butter/and many others. – often totally cooked dinner leftovers aren’t nice for composting until they’re tremendous plain (like plain rice), however the leftover scraps and uncooked supplies that went into the cooking – these leftover kale stems, or the ends of the veggies you chop off, and many others. – are!

Does the compost bin require any repairs?
A bit, however not a lot!
Sarah stated it’s useful so as to add a bit water in there each few weeks, and that you simply must also stir all the things a pair instances a month with a big shovel of some type.
In the winter, it’s not as essential to stir the compost since all the things can be frozen/not breaking down anyway, however as soon as it’s sizzling out you undoubtedly wish to stir it each couple weeks. Be positive so as to add in some yard waste – leaves, and many others. – to your compost pile along with meals scraps. There’s extra info on the EPA web site relating to methods to handle your compost bin correctly when it comes to what steadiness of yard waste vs. meals waste to incorporate.
A correctly managed compost bin shouldn’t scent unhealthy, and shouldn’t appeal to pests or rodents.
